After shouting that he wanted a new defense attorney at his last court appearance Sept. 29, one of the two alleged co-conspirators to a Hillsborough woman charged with conspiring to murder the father of her two children is set to receive new legal counsel, according to the San Mateo County District Attorney’s Office.
Kaveh Bayat
Charles Smith and John Halley, two defense attorneys retained for Kaveh Bayat, were relieved of their responsibilities Thursday and the county’s private defender program was appointed to his case. He will next appear in court Nov. 14 with his new lawyer and to set a new trial date, according to prosecutors.

Bayat, 31, is known to be the boyfriend of Tiffany Li, 32, who is charged with conspiring to murder Keith Green, a Millbrae man and father of her children. Li, along with Bayat, who is believed to have pulled the trigger of the gun that killed Green, and 42-year-old Olivier Adella, a Burlingame man who’s been accused as the muscle behind the crime, are facing murder charges in the shooting death of 27-year-old Green, with whom Li was alleged to have a custody dispute at the time of his disappearance April 29, 2016, according to prosecutors.

Almost two weeks after Green met up with Li at a Millbrae pancake house the evening he disappeared, his body was discovered near a Sonoma County homeless encampment May 11, according to prosecutors.
Though Li posted $35 million bail by putting up several Bay Area properties valued at $62 million along with $4 million in cash in April, Bayat remains in custody with bail set at $35 million, according to prosecutors.
